  2. Lillian Elizabeth Randolph, 56, was kidnapped from her rural home near Guthrie Center, Iowa, on Mother’s Day, Sunday, May 2, 1965. On May 11, state authorities found her body in the trunk of her car at the Polk County Municipal Airport in Des Moines. She was stabbed 13 times.

  4. May 2, 2010 · Lillian had been stabbed 13 times. Officials have long believed that Lillians estranged husband, Howard Fitz Randolph, hired two men to kidnap and then kill his wife after he left that Sunday to take the two younger girls to the Ice Follies.
